Position: Commis Chef β€” Elevate Quality with Consistent Dishes
Hyatt Hotels Corporation in Doha is seeking a Commis Chef to deliver high-quality food and excellent customer service. The role involves preparing consistent and high-quality food products while ensuring professional and flexible service that supports the operating concept of the outlet. Candidates should have experience as a Commis Chef or Apprentice in a reputable hotel or restaurant. This position offers a dynamic work environment in a prestigious hospitality setting.
